Site selection by Microphallus pygmaeus Levinsen, 1881 (Trematoda: Microphallidae) in the laboratory mouse

Insights

Microphallus pygmaeus worms showed high mortality in mice, with survivors establishing in the ileum for egg production. Most parasites were eliminated within 12 days, indicating limited establishment success.

Background:

  • Microphallus pygmaeus is a digenean trematode parasite.
  • Understanding parasite establishment and lifecycle in a host is crucial for disease control.

Purpose of the Study:

  • To investigate the establishment, distribution, and lifecycle of Microphallus pygmaeus in laboratory mice.

Main Methods:

  • Oral inoculation of Microphallus pygmaeus into laboratory mice.
  • Monitoring parasite distribution and development over 12 days post-inoculation.

Main Results:

  • High initial mortality of Microphallus pygmaeus specimens.
  • Successful establishment and oviposition in the ileum by day 1 post-inoculation.
  • Parasite elimination completed by day 12, with significant mortality throughout.

Conclusions:

  • Microphallus pygmaeus exhibits limited success in establishing in laboratory mice.
  • The ileum is the primary site for parasite establishment and egg production.
  • The lifecycle in mice is short, with rapid elimination of most parasites.
